A former professional rugby union player, who who died in 2023 at the age of 33, has become the first in New Zealand to be formally diagnosed with chronic traumatic encephalopathy – the neurogenerative disease associated with repeated head trauma. Billy Guyton died of a suspected suicide last year, CNN affiliate Radio New Zealand reported, and his family subsequently donated his brain to Auckland’s Neurological Foundation Human Brain Bank which made the CTE diagnosis.
“The poor guy would spend hours in a small, dark cupboard because he couldn’t handle being in the light,” John Guyton told RNZ. “Some mornings he’d just sit in the bottom of his shower tray crying, trying to muster up the energy to get moving.
